If anyone has any objections, please let me know. ------------------ From: Maher Sanalla [ Upstream commit dec47e4b0fe34afdf38caa72b4408ba95502e5de ] set_user_buf_size() computes the QP buffer size by left-shifting the user-supplied rq.wqe_cnt and rq.wqe_shift values as signed integers. A sufficiently large rq.wqe_cnt causes signed integer overflow, which is undefined behavior, and yields a small or negative buf_size, causing ib_umem_get() to map a buffer smaller than the hardware will actually write into. Replace the shifts and addition with check_shl_overflow() and check_add_overflow(), rejecting invalid user inputs. Moreover, guard the identical shift computing qp->sq.offset in _create_user_qp() before set_user_buf_size() is reached.
